This role will ideally be based in the Benelux region.

Our client is a global, privately owned company focused on innovating, optimizing and managing the supply chains of leading brands. Founded in 1974, our client employs more than 10,000 people and serves customers in more than 100 countries.

Job Description:

In this Communications Manager role, you will be responsible for driving the planning and execution of communications initiatives in support of the business strategies, with focus on supporting internal communications and digital communications activities.

You will also develop content for external digital channels (social media and web) and sales enablement tools. You will partner with internal subject matter experts and communications and marketing colleagues to drive employee engagement and behaviours that support business results and the company’s employee value proposition.

Additional responsibilities in this exciting role:

  • Develop and execute initiative-specific internal communication plans, particularly related to changes, program and initiatives.
  • Support relevant content creation for social media, including managing the editorial calendar, writing content and guiding the development of visuals and other creative assets on platforms including Twitter, LinkedIn, Vimeo and Glassdoor.
  • Support content creation for PR and Marketing Communications materials, including, but not limited to press releases, product overviews, case studies, white papers, presentations, conference materials, newsletters.
  • Support the ongoing implementation of the companies Digital Workplace including the management and development of Logistics content for the corporate intranet.
  • Acts as a ‘Digital Ambassador’ to develop tools that support communication capability/digital literacy among employees.
  • Partner with internal customers and subject matter experts to identify messages and develop effective content.
  • Partner with communication colleagues and external vendors as needed to execute variety of communication tools and channels.
  • Coordinate the development and delivery of internal communications across the Logistics regions and functions to ensure alignment, consistency, and sharing of best practices.
  • Assist with development and execution of internal and external meetings and events as needed.
  • Track metrics to evaluate effectiveness of communication programs and tools
  • Manage project costs.
